RadNet has reported its financial results for the second quarter of 2026, posting record revenue and adjusted EBITDA. The company saw total revenue climb 25 percent to $622.7 million, up from $498.2 million in the same period last year. This marks a new quarterly high for the imaging services provider.
The company's Digital Health segment also set a record, with revenue jumping 56.5 percent to $32.4 million compared to $20.7 million in the second quarter of 2025. That figure includes intersegment revenue. More notably, the segment's Annual Recurring Revenue, or ARR, more than doubled year over year, rising from $53.5 million at the end of June 2025 to $105.5 million as of June 30, 2026. The sharp growth in ARR points to strong adoption of RadNet's AI and digital products, which are becoming a larger part of its overall business mix.
Given the strong performance, RadNet has revised its financial guidance for 2026 upward. The company now expects higher ranges for both revenue and adjusted EBITDA, reflecting continued momentum across its core imaging centers and its newer digital offerings. Management attributed the results to steady patient volumes, improved reimbursement, and successful integration of recent acquisitions.
The company said it remains focused on expanding its footprint and advancing its AI-driven diagnostic tools. With the first half of the year complete, RadNet is on pace to deliver another year of solid growth. Investors responded positively to the news, with shares moving higher in after-hours trading.
